Re: LOOKS GOOD

Originally posted by MOBOY
How much were the wheels and tires. Did you go to tirerack to get them? I like the lowered stance! I have 17's now with 55 series...is that what you had previously? I guess once you had the springs put on you did an allignment. I thought doing a 17" 45 series combo would mess up the spedo and stuff.
I bought the wheels separately (I already had the 235/45 tires). They ran about 1K. I originally had the 16" with 215/55 tires (i got my max in July of '99). When I changed the rims/tires I took it for an alignment and didn't need it, no camber adjustment either. As for the speedometer, it didn't make a difference because the overall diameter falls between the two stock options. Right now, the diameter is greater then the 16" 215/55 stock combo but less than the 17" 225/50 stock combo.

Originally posted by Dave Lopez
Nice pics!!!! I have a question about your tires??? Im in the market for the same exact tires that you have(Nitto 555 235/45-17). I have Alessio Futura rims on my car with the factory Bridgestone RE 92s. MY rims are 17x7 and IM wondering if 235/45-17s will fit on my 17x7 inch rims. So my question to you is....what size are your rims? 17 x ????? How well do the tires fit on your rims? How do you like the tires??? [/I]
I have the Nitto 555 235/45/17s on my car. They handle great, but they are a bit bumpy. I dunno if the 225/50's would have been a bit less rough. I will be looking a bit harder when these tires finally wear. The ride is just a bit too rough sometimes so I may have to pick a softer tire that might not last as long.

The Nittos were highly recommended by the guy at American Tire. He said it was a good balance between handling, ride, and durability.
